Tremco Construction Products Group brings together Tremco CPG Inc.'s Commercial Sealants & Waterproofing and Roofing & Building Maintenance divisions; Tremco Barrier Solutions Inc.; Dryvit, Nudura and Willseal brands; Prebuck LLC; Weatherproofing Technologies, Inc.; Weatherproofing Technologies Canada and PureAir Control Services, Inc. Altogether, Tremco CPG companies operate 21 manufacturing facilities, 6 distribution sites, and 3 R&D / technology sites, and employ more than 2,700 people across North America.

GENERAL PURPOSE OF THE JOB :

The Manufacturing Engineer's responsibilities are broad and include safety, product quality, process control, productivity improvement, and development of a LEAN culture. The Manufacturing Engineer is expected to spend a significant amount of time on the floor and lead large capital project teams.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ES :

  • Safety

Assume a leadership position at the facility in partnership with the Plant Manager, Facilities & Engineering Manager and Shift Supervisors. Activities include resolution and communication regarding safety issues.

  • Execute on scheduled PHA's and JSA's.
  • Proactively monitor area and remediate potential safety issues.
  • Use DAKOTA software as a tool for compliance and environmental, health and safety. Use the tool to report incidents, near misses, and non-conformances.
  • LEAN Culture
  • Active participant in MS-168 Management Operating System.

  • Develop and execute upon "standard work" activities.
  • Continuous Improvement champion promoting and driving the "Small K" program.
  • Conduct "GEMBA Walks" daily. Use walks as the primary means of education and communication of expectations.
  • Improve productivity through elimination of non-value-added activities. Apply Engineering principles and methodologies to improve productivity and eliminate waste.
  • Maintain and continually improve the plant layout and flow.
